One of the key factors driving the Bay Area housing market is the region’s strong economy. The Bay Area is home to some of the world’s largest and most innovative companies, which has led to a steady influx of high-paying jobs. This influx of workers has increased demand for housing, which has in turn pushed up prices. Another factor driving the Bay Area housing market is the limited supply of housing. The Bay Area is a relatively small region with a limited amount of land available for development. This limited supply has made it difficult to build new homes, which has further pushed up prices.

Predicting the Impact of Economic Growth and Interest Rates

Factors Influencing Bay Area Housing Market Predictions

Economic growth and interest rates play crucial roles in shaping the Bay Area housing market. While economic growth typically leads to increased demand for housing, rising interest rates can dampen demand by making borrowing more expensive.

Economic Growth in Bay Area

The Bay Area is expected to continue experiencing steady economic growth in the coming years. This growth is driven by the region’s thriving tech sector and its position as a major hub for innovation and entrepreneurship.

Interest Rates and Housing Market

Interest rates significantly impact housing affordability. When interest rates are low, borrowing becomes more affordable, increasing demand for homes and leading to price increases. Conversely, rising interest rates reduce affordability, dampening demand and potentially cooling the housing market.
